Şimdi Ara

PHP yardım - Cookie ile sepete ekle

Daha Fazla
Bu Konudaki Kullanıcılar: Daha Az
2 Misafir (1 Mobil) - 1 Masaüstü1 Mobil
5 sn
4
Cevap
0
Favori
738
Tıklama
Daha Fazla
İstatistik
  • Konu İstatistikleri Yükleniyor
Öne Çıkar
0 oy
Sayfa: 1
Giriş
Mesaj
  • Cookie post methoduyla gönderilen verileri tutar mı? Post metoduyla gönderilen yazıları her seferinde göndermeden o sayfaya girdiğinde göstermenin yolu nedir?

    Sepete ekle sayfasına sepete ekle butonuna bastığımda post metoduyla bilgi göndertiyorum. Ancak sepete ekle sayfasında kullanıcı refresh yaptığında gidiyor gönderilenler. Kalsın istiyorum vveritabanına kayıt etmiyorum. Üye girişi de yok sadece cookie ile verileri tutmak istiyorum post ile gönderilen.

     PHP yardım - Cookie ile sepete ekle

    sepet.php, burdaki postlar çekildikten sonra kayıt edilsin itsiyorum f5 yapınca gitmesin bunu cookie ile sağlamak mümkünmü veya session?
     PHP yardım - Cookie ile sepete ekle



    _____________________________




  • Cookie oldukça küçük miktarda (4K) veri tutmak içindir. Ayrıca cookie'ler dışarıdan müdahale edilmeye açık oldukları için önemli verileri saklamak için önerilmezler.

    Sorduğun sorunun cevabı Session kullanmaktan geçiyor. Session bilgileri "sunucu" tarafında saklanırlar ve bu yüzden daha güvenlidirler. Ayrıca çok daha fazla miktarda veri tutabilirsin.

    https://www.phpr.org/php-session-oturum-yonetimi/
  • Cevabı arkadaş vermiş.



    sayfanın başına

    session_start (); eklerseniz.

    $_SESSION["product1"] = $Sepete_EklenenUrun;



    Daha sonra alma sayfasında session start eklersiniz



    $_SESSION["product"] = $gelen_urun;



    dediğinizde biraz size bağlı olarak bu session ile gelecektir.



    Kolay gelsin.

    < Bu ileti mobil sürüm kullanılarak atıldı >
    _____________________________
  • Üstteki arkadasin da yazdığı gibi verileri sessionda tutabilirsin hocam, birden fazla ürün için arasına virgül gibi ayraçlar koyup PHP de tekrar bolebilirsin. Yani her virgüle geldiğinde yeni bir veri oluşturur arrayde $array[0], $array[1] diye gider. Bir de fonksiyon yaparsın for ile, empty olana kadar arrayde listelersin işlem tamam

    < Bu ileti mobil sürüm kullanılarak atıldı >
    _____________________________
  • Yapay Zeka’dan İlgili Konular
    SİTEME HTML KOD NASIL EKLERİM
    12 yıl önce açıldı
    Daha Fazla Göster
    
Sayfa: 1
- x
Bildirim
mesajınız kopyalandı (ctrl+v) yapıştırmak istediğiniz yere yapıştırabilirsiniz.